Our featured artist series continues this month with the work of Abigail Engstrand! Here is some info on the exhibition from the artist herself:

"My art is an ever changing concoction, fresh combinations of old methods and materials, to create cheer, or reflect on life. I am working with wool roving, silk roving, silk fabric, scraps of silk blouse and boxers, cashmere sweaters and gloves, locks of alpaca and dog hair, fibers that have been carded and combed and dyed, and I arrange them into my compositions to mimic my subject matter . I poke them into place with a felting needle, by hand and machine. Lots of color and depth to savor here. Cheers! Have any questions? Contact me.
